Game Preview

Achievements– Present Perfect

  •  English    8     Public
    Talk about life achievements and experiences using the present perfect tense.
  •   Study   Slideshow
  • I___ (visit) Paris twice.
    have visited
  •  20
  • He___ (learn) to drive recently.
    has learned
  •  20
  • I___(write) five blog posts so far.
    have written
  •  20
  • She ___(never be) to New York.
    has never been
  •  20
  • You___ (complete) the task, right?
    have completed
  •  20
  • They___ (break) the record again.
    have broken
  •  20
  • They___ (not finish) the report yet.
    haven’t finished
  •  20
  • She___ (win) three awards this year.
    has won
  •  20